Bogdan Melnik
Oferta, która wygrała- Zlecenia 9
- Ocena -
- Ranking 427
Budżet: 1700 UAH Termin: 3 dni
Witam, jestem doświadczonym front-end deweloperem. Z doświadczeniem w pracy ponad 4 lata.
Doświadczenie w pracy z ciekawym projektem i animacjami.
Ostatnie z najlepszych prac:
HTTP://melnikportfolio.site/onedesign/
HTTP://melnikportfolio.site/mine/
HTTP://melnikportfolio.site/sidw/switch_page.html
HTTP://melnikportfolio.site/snooker/
Porozmawiajmy o szczegółach i zacznę pracować!
Budżet: 500 UAH Termin: 1 dzień
Przygotowując się do realizacji Twojego projektu piszesz, z przyjemnością będę współpracować.
Dziękuję !
Budżet: 700 UAH Termin: 2 dni
Dzień dobry !
Przygotuj się do szybkiego i wysokiej jakości wykonania zamówienia.
Czekam na dalsze komentarze na temat projektu. Będę zadowolony z powrotów
Budżet: 1000 UAH Termin: 3 dni
Dzień dobry, bardzo interesuje mnie Twój projekt. Poznałem Twoją TZ, ale nie rozumiem niektórych drobnych rzeczy.
Mogę zacząć pracować natychmiast po omówieniu wszystkich szczegółów, choć teraz.
Napiszcie .
Oferty ukryte
Aktualnie brak ofert
Aktualne zlecenia dla freelancerów w kategorii Programowanie stron internetowych
Potrzebny doświadczony programista Laravel do integracji systemu płatności w istniejącym projekcie. O projekcie Backend: Laravel Frontend: React Projekt: chmurowa platforma do przechowywania plików (odpowiednik Dropbox) Co należy zrealizować Integrację płatności kartami bankowymi przez API systemu płatności. Tworzenie płatności. Przekierowanie użytkownika na stronę płatności. Obsługę udanej i nieudanej płatności. Obsługę callback/webhook. Sprawdzenie statusu płatności. Poprawną zmianę statusu zamówienia po udanej płatności. Logowanie zapytań i odpowiedzi API. Pracę zarówno w środowisku testowym, jak i produkcyjnym. Wymagania Doskonała znajomość Laravel. Doświadczenie w integracji systemów płatności (API bankowe itp.). Doświadczenie w pracy z REST API. Bedzie to atutem Doświadczenie w integracji bankowych bramek płatniczych. Możliwość pokazania podobnych projektów. Co zapewnimy Pełną dokumentację techniczną systemu płatności. Dostęp do środowiska testowego. Przy odpowiedzi proszę podać: 1. Jakie systemy płatności już zintegrowałeś. 2. Koszt pracy. 3. Czas realizacji. 4. Przykłady podobnych projektów (jeśli są).
ZADANIE TECHNICZNE Opracowanie systemu Digital Signage dla sieci ekranów reklamowych 1. Ogólny opis systemuSystem przeznaczony do zdalnego zarządzania treściami multimedialnymi (wideo, obrazy) w sieci telewizorów działających na Android TV. Architektura:Backend / Panel sterowania (Admin): PHP (Laravel / Yii2 lub czysty PHP) + MySQL.Frontend (Odtwarzacz na TV): HTML5 / JavaScript (Aplikacja Jednostronicowa), uruchamiana na TV w trybie pełnoekranowym przez aplikację Fully Kiosk Browser.2. Wymagania funkcjonalne: Panel sterowania (Admin na PHP)2.1. Zarządzanie ekranami (Telewizorami)Możliwość dodawania/usuwania ekranów w systemie.Każdemu ekranowi przypisywana jest: Nazwa (geo-punkt), unikalny ID (device_token) oraz status (Online/Offline).Monitorowanie (Ping): Wyświetlanie statusu TV w czasie rzeczywistym. Jeśli TV nie wysyłał zapytań przez więcej niż 5 minut, status powinien być pomalowany na czerwono (Offline). 2.2. Zarządzanie treścią (Biblioteka mediów)Przesyłanie plików (wideo, obrazy) na serwer.Usuwanie plików (z automatycznym usunięciem fizycznego pliku z serwera).Możliwość przeglądania (i zmieniania), na których ekranach jest emitowany każdy pojedynczy plik multimedialny.Ustawienie kolejności odtwarzania plików. 2.3. API serwera (do komunikacji z TV)Zrealizować REST API (JSON):POST /api/ping — przyjmuje od TV jego ID, rejestruje czas ostatniej aktywności (dla statusu Online) i zwraca aktualną wersję playlisty.GET /api/file/device_token — zwraca aktualną tablicę JSON z linkami do plików multimedialnych, ich kolejnością oraz ustawieniami czasu wyświetlania.3. Wymagania funkcjonalne: Odtwarzacz kliencki (HTML5/JS na TV)Odtwarzacz jest stroną internetową, która jest otwarta na TV. Główne zadanie klienta — autonomia.3.1. Cache i synchronizacja (Praca bez internetu)Przy starcie odtwarzacz żąda playlisty przez API.Lokalne przechowywanie: Wszystkie pliki z playlisty (wideo/obrazy) JS powinien ładować do wewnętrznej pamięci przeglądarki (używając Cache API lub IndexedDB). Streaming (odtwarzanie bezpośrednio z internetu) jest zabroniony.Synchronizacja: Jeśli na serwerze dodano nową treść, odtwarzacz ładuje ją w tle, nie przerywając aktualnego pokazu. Po zakończeniu ładowania — dodaje do transmisji. Jeśli treść została usunięta na serwerze, odtwarzacz musi usunąć ją z lokalnej pamięci podręcznej TV, aby nie zapełniać pamięci urządzenia.Tryb offline: Przy całkowitym zniknięciu internetu odtwarzacz nieskończoność powtarza ostatnią pomyślnie załadowaną playlistę. 3.2. Odtwarzanie i rotacjaCykliczne odtwarzanie treści i zgodnie z ustaloną w adminie kolejnością.Dla obrazów należy ustawić czas wyświetlania w sekundach (domyślnie 10 sek).Przejścia między filmami powinny być płynne, bez czarnych ekranów i zauważalnego przeładowania strony. 3.3. Logowanie i kontrola błędów (Ochrona przed awariami)Obsługa uszkodzonych plików: Jeśli plik wideo jest uszkodzony i nie może być odtworzony, odtwarzacz powinien go pominąć i włączyć następny w kolejności, a nie zawieszać się na czarnym ekranie.Logi pokazów (Analiza): Odtwarzacz powinien zapisywać w lokalnej pamięci fakt każdego pomyślnego odtworzenia filmu. Po pojawieniu się internetu te dane są wysyłane na serwer (POST /api/logs), aby w adminie można było zobaczyć statystyki: "Film A na TV nr 3 był wyświetlany 450 razy w ciągu doby oraz 2365 razy łącznie".4. Wymagania dotyczące optymalizacji pod Android TVInterfejs odtwarzacza nie powinien zawierać żadnych elementów sterujących (kursory, paski przewijania, przyciski). Tylko czysta treść na cały ekran.Kod JS musi być zoptymalizowany pod kątem pamięci (na czas usuwania nieużywanych elementów DOM i obiektowych URL), ponieważ budżetowe telewizory mają surowe ograniczenia dotyczące pamięci RAM i mogą awaryjnie zamykać kartę przy wycieku pamięci po 12-24 godzinach ciągłej pracy.
Opis zadania: Szukamy dewelopera do stworzenia prostej systemu zarządzania miejscami parkingowymi bez miesięcznych płatnych subskrypcji pod klucz. Co jest dostępne: Gotowy szczegółowy rysunek parkingu w formacie DWG (AutoCAD). Łącznie około 500 miejsc parkingowych.Główne zadanie: Należy przenieść ten rysunek do interfejsu webowego, aby każde miejsce parkingowe stało się klikalne i dynamicznie zmieniało kolor (na przykład Zielony — Wolne, Czerwony — Zajęte). To elektroniczny rejestr długoterminowego wynajmu (planowane ręczne wprowadzanie danych przez menedżera, automatyzacja z czujnikami, szlabanami czy kamerami nie jest potrzebna).Podział ról i dostęp: Menedżer: Pracuje z komputera w biurze. Ma dostęp do "panelu administracyjnego", gdzie może zmienić status każdego z miejsc parkingowych (wolne/zajęte) oraz wpisać opis (na przykład nazwę firmy najemcy). Ochrona: Znajduje się na terenie obiektu, łączy się z urządzeń mobilnych (telefon, tablet lub laptop) przez mobilny internet. Ochrona ma dostęp tylko do przeglądania (Read-only). Klikają na miejsce i widzą informacje: Numer miejsca, Status, Nazwa firmy. Nie mają możliwości wprowadzenia zmian.Wymagania dotyczące realizacji: Praca pod klucz: od adaptacji rysunku do webu po wdrożenie systemu i bazy danych. Interfejs mapy musi być responsywny dla wygodnego skalowania i kliknięć palcami na ekranach smartfonów. Proszę zaproponować optymalny sposób umiejscowienia systemu: albo wdrożenie na naszym biurowym komputerze (będzie potrzebna konfiguracja dostępu zewnętrznego dla mobilnego internetu ochrony), albo wykorzystanie darmowych limitów chmurowych.Proszę w odpowiedzi zapropnować swój wariant stosu technologicznego oraz architektury (gdzie najlepiej hostować bazę, aby ochrona miała dostęp z 4G), a także podać orientacyjną cenę i terminy realizacji projektu. Ważna uwaga dotycząca budżetu i funkcjonalności: Projekt jest realizowany wyłącznie do użytku wewnętrznego i podstawowej wygody. Nie potrzebujemy skomplikowanych rozwiązań designerskich, systemów CRM, integracji z bramkami płatniczymi, powiadomień SMS i tym podobnych. Potrzebny jest maksymalnie prosty, zwięzły i działający interfejs bez zbędnego kodu. Dlatego proszę oceniać projekt adekwatnie — oferty z zawyżonymi cenami nie będą rozpatrywane. Dziękujemy
Potrzebny doświadczony programista OpenCart do przejęcia projektu i dalszego wsparcia Szukam doświadczonego programisty OpenCart (nie agencji), który profesjonalnie przejmie sklep internetowy od obecnego dewelopera i zajmie się jego wsparciem, rozwojem i optymalizacją SEO. O projekcie Sklep internetowy na OpenCart. Projekt gotowy w około 99% i sprawdzony zgodnie z wymaganiami technicznymi. Potrzebne jest przeprowadzenie niezależnego audytu technicznego przed ostatecznym przekazaniem strony. Po zakończeniu przekazania planowana jest długoterminowa współpraca przy rozwoju projektu. Podstawowe zadania Przeprowadzenie audytu kodu i struktury projektu. Sprawdzenie jakości realizacji funkcjonalności. Sprawdzenie zainstalowanych modułów, ich kompatybilności i poprawności działania. Ocena bezpieczeństwa i stabilności działania strony. Sprawdzenie wydajności i zaproponowanie rekomendacji dotyczących jej poprawy. Sprawdzenie zrealizowanej części SEO i zaproponowanie dalszego planu optymalizacji. Upewnienie się, że projekt jest w pełni gotowy do samodzielnego wsparcia bez zależności od poprzedniego dewelopera. Sprawdzenie poprawności przekazania wszystkich dostępów: kod źródłowy; baza danych; FTP; hosting; domena; e-mail; panel administracyjny; zainstalowane moduły i ich licencje. W razie potrzeby udział w komunikacji z obecnym deweloperem podczas przekazywania projektu. Przedstawić listę rekomendacji i uwag przed ostatecznym przyjęciem. Dalsza współpraca Po przyjęciu strony planowana jest regularna praca nad projektem: rozwój nowych funkcjonalności; optymalizacja SEO; poprawa wydajności; integracje z zewnętrznymi usługami; wsparcie techniczne. Wymagania dla kandydata Potrzebny specjalista, który: ma znaczące doświadczenie w pracy z OpenCart; dobrze zna architekturę OpenCart i popularne moduły; ma doświadczenie w audycie i wsparciu istniejących projektów; może argumentować jakość wykonanych prac; odpowiedzialnie podchodzi do ustaleń i przestrzega uzgodnionych terminów realizacji prac; jest zainteresowany długoterminową współpracą. W odpowiedzi proszę podać doświadczenie w pracy z OpenCart; przykłady zrealizowanych sklepów internetowych; czy przeprowadzałeś audyt lub przyjęcie cudzych projektów; orientacyjną cenę: audytu technicznego; udziału w przyjęciu projektu; wsparcia godzinowego lub projektowego po przekazaniu. Preferencje będą miały osoby, które mają wieloletnie doświadczenie w pracy z OpenCart, odpowiedzialnie podchodzą do swojej pracy, przestrzegają uzgodnionych terminów i są gotowe stać się technicznym partnerem projektu na długi czas.
Potrzebna jest migracja sklepu internetowego Opencart z PHP 7.4 na PHP 8.x. Obecnie zainstalowane jest jądro w wersji 3.0.3.8. Czytamy, że najprawdopodobniej będzie trzeba również zaktualizować jądro do wersji 4.0 i że nie powinno być większych trudności... Funkcjonalność jest głównie niestandardowa, są również Simple, OCFilter, Nowa poczta. Oczekujemy rekomendacji i orientacyjnej ceny. Idealnie, jeśli ktoś już przeprowadzał podobną pracę.